Bandol: pink or white.

It’s a slight culture shock as a moron gringo in the South of France when wines by the glass are identified not by producer or even by grape but simply by place. Bandol didn’t mean much to me as a place, I drove through it en route to Toulon from Marseille but that was about it. Probably it was the fact that it was a vague homonym for bandit drew me to it — which is admittedly kind of lame, but the wine seemed to deliver. Any more than the progeny of any other Mediterranean town would have? Je ne sais pas. But this wine right here is a phenomenal rosé.

50% Mourvèdre, 40% Cinsault, 10% Grenache from Bandol.

Domaine Zind Humbrecht

Calcaire Alsace Pinot Gris

Anyone who thinks Pinot Gris is a lame apple-flavored substitute for white wine needs to try this. Very fragrant with aromas of peaches, apricots, pear, petrol, and to no one's surprise, calcareous minerals. Background notes of baking spices and honey. Oily, acidic finish characteristic of Alsatian whites. It's also unfair to rate this against the world's finest Rieslings and Chardonnays, so I completely disagree with those who give it a mere 89-91. I also think with age, this would skyrocket to a 95+ wine. — 5 years ago

Tenuta Argentiera

Bolgheri Superiore Cabernet Sauvignon Blend 2015

Alex Lallos
9.2

When first opened it was generic and lame but with an hour it is really turning into something special. Beautiful nose (albeit showing a lot of vanilla and oak) but with Bolgheri class. Saline, red cherry and cola followed by mild dill. It is a beautifully crafted wine that needs time to show itself. I would love to see this in 10 years. Modern and seriously well built. Class act — 6 years ago
